I only believe this to be a regression of the installer. But basically what
happens is, I am installing the game and once it comes to the part where it
needs the second disk, it brings that dialog up asking for it. I go into my
gnome-terminal window and make a new tabe and issue the command "wine eject".
When I do so, the disk ejects and I insert the second disk. But when I go back
to the installer and I hit "Yes" to retry and probe for the second disk, it does
nothing. It simply flickers for a quick second like its doing something and
brings the dialog back up. Its very frustrating and I've searched for solutions
and wasnt able to find any.
